Apple overnight oats
By Kelsey Harms, Nutrition Assistant

  • ½ cup oatmeal
  • ½ cup low fat milk
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¼ teaspoon cinnamon
  • ½ cup fat-free plain yogurt
  • 1 small apple, diced
  1. In a medium bowl: mix oats, milk, ¼ teaspoon of cinnamon, and ¼ teaspoon vanilla extract.
  2. Cover and refrigerate for at least 6 hours, until oats are soft and have absorbed most of the liquid.
  3. In a small bowl: mix yogurt with ¼ teaspoon of vanilla extract.
  4. In a tall glass or bowl: mix (or layer) the oatmeal, yogurt, and apples.

Other Ideas:

  • Heat oatmeal in the microwave in the morning.
  • Substitute low fat milk with another milk alternative of choice.
  • Add extra spices such as hazelnut and nutmeg for more flavor.
  • Add granola or mixed nuts for a little crunch.
